A sword-swinging samurai, a corpse-robbing crone and a falsely accused trans man stand at the center of these four iconic tales, once the inspiration for a classic film, now turned into stunning graphic novellas.
The stories in this volume by Ryunosuke Akutagawa - the renowned "father of the Japanese short story" are captured by manga masters mkdeville and Philippe Nicloux in these four action-packed adaptations. Rashomon: A houseless servant pits morality against survival in a post-apocalyptic world where thievery and the desecration of the dead are necessary for survival.
In the Grove: Conflicting statements and competing narratives call into question the notion of objective truth in a searing tale of rape and revenge. Otomi's Virginity: Pride, honor and dignity are at stake when a young servant is confronted by an unexpected aggressor at her employer's abandoned house. The Martyr: A pious Jesuit with a dark secret faces excommunication and death in 16th-century Japan, when Christianity was introduced and then banned by order of the Shogun.
Stunning graphic adaptations turn these iconic tales into thrilling page-turners, following in the footsteps of the famous Kurosawa film.
